So basically, tomorrow - June 1 (or June 2nd for you in the US) marks the ten year anniversary of the album Adore. This is my personal favourite album by the band and I still maintain that it is often criminally underated. I wont go into detail about the album as Im sure most of you already know loads about it, but I think its cool to reflect on the album's impact over ten years. Although it never really gained any great success its influences can be seen in lots of contemporary music and in some ways the album is still way ahead of this time.
